Ductwork repl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ged air ducts and installing new systems to ensure efficient airflow throughout a property. This process typically includes inspecting existing duct systems, removing compromised sections, and fitting new ducts that meet current standards. The goal is to improve indoor air quality, optimize HVAC performance, and reduce energy costs by ensuring that airflow is unobstructed and properly balanced. Professionals often use specialized tools and materials to ensure a seamless installation that minimizes disruptions to the property.

Replacing ductwork can address a variety of issues that impact comfort and system efficiency. Common problems include leaks, cracks, or corrosion that cause air loss and uneven heating or cooling. Over time, ducts may become clogged with debris or develop mold growth, which can compromise indoor air quality. By upgrading the duct system, property owners can experience more consistent temperatures, reduced allergy symptoms, and lower energy bills. Properly installed ductwork also helps prevent future system failures and costly repairs by maintaining optimal airflow and system integrity.

Replacement Costs - The cost for ductwork replacement typ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000 depending on the size of the system and property. For example, a standard home may incur expenses around $2,500 to $3,500. Variations depend on duct material and complexity of installation.

Material Expenses - Duct material costs can vary between $2 to $10 per linear foot, with flexible ducts usually being more affordable than sheet metal options. For a typical residence, material costs might total between $500 and $2,000. The choice of material influences overall project expenses.

Labor Fees - Labor charges for ductwork replacement generally range from $50 to $100 per hour, totaling $1,000 to $3,000 for most projects. Larger or more complex systems may require additional labor hours, increasing overall costs. Local pros provide estimates based on specific property requirements.

Additional Costs - Additional expenses may include duct sealing, insulation, or modifications, which can add $200 to $1,000 to the project. These costs depend on existing duct conditions and the extent of upgrades needed. Contact local service providers for detailed cost assessments.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that ductwork needs to be replaced? Common indicators include inconsistent airflow, increased energy bills, or visible damage such as leaks or corrosion, suggesting that replacement may be necessary.

How long does ductwork replacement typically take? The duration varies based on the size of the system and property, but many projects can be completed within a day or two by local service providers.

Is ductwork replacement disruptive to daily routines? Some disruption may occur during installation, but experienced contractors aim to minimize inconvenience and complete work efficiently.

Are there different types of ductwork materials available? Yes, options include flexible, sheet metal, and fiberglass ducts, each suited to different needs and preferences.
